This eye-catching itinerary definitely delivers as far as seeing the best of the Rockies is concerned, with glorious scenery at almost every turn.
Vancouver is your starting point and it’s a true gem of a city. Set between the mountains and sea, where the Seawall skirts beaches and towering trees, then continues past gleaming skyscrapers and hip neighbourhoods that surround the downtown core. Sights to tick off your list include lush Stanley Park, the old-town district of Gastown, historic Chinatown, thriving Granville Island and Commercial Drive for the city’s best shopping.
Drive on to Kamloops, a city of contrasts that nestles at the confluence of two mighty rivers in the heart of the Thompson Valley. It’s a place to head out on a wine-tasting tour, tee off at a picturesque golf course, or simply step out and revel in the mountains, vast valleys and sparkling lakes on the doorstep.
UNESCO listed Jasper National Park is also not short on sights, scenery and adventure with shimmering glaciers, crystalline lakes, thundering waterfalls, deep canyons and evergreen forest all watched over by towering peaks.
Next up is magical Lake Louise, a stunning showstopper whose beauty will stop you in your tracks as you stand and gaze at its emerald-green water, soaring mountain backdrop and glistening glacier. Paddle across the lake or explore the surrounding trails on foot, either way Lake Louise is simply picture-perfect whatever the time of year you visit.
The charming town Banff then beckons, which has boutiques to browse, art galleries and museums, as well as tempting bars and restaurants. Of course, you must also travel out to Banff National Park, to get your final fix of mesmerising vistas. Here, the mountainous terrain is packed with spectacularly scenic valleys, peaks, glaciers, forests, meadows and rivers not to mention amazing wildlife.
With memories to last a lifetime, return to Calgary for your flight back to the UK.
